无论是开发测试、教育培训、系统迁移,还是多系统并行,虚拟机都以其独特的优势赢得了广泛的认可
推荐工具:一键关闭windows 自动更新、windows defender(IIS7服务器助手)
然而,对于许多用户而言,一个关键问题始终悬而未决:虚拟机的Windows系统真的能够流畅运行吗?本文将通过深入解析虚拟机的工作原理、性能影响因素以及实际测试体验,为您揭示真相
一、虚拟机的工作原理与优势 虚拟机(Virtual Machine, VM)是一种通过软件模拟的具有完整硬件系统功能的计算机系统
它允许在一台物理机上同时运行多个操作系统实例,每个实例都拥有自己的CPU、内存、硬盘等虚拟资源
这一技术的核心在于虚拟化层(Hypervisor),它负责在物理硬件与虚拟机之间建立抽象层,管理并分配资源
虚拟机的优势显著: 1.资源隔离:每个虚拟机独立运行,互不影响,保障了系统的安全性和稳定性
2.灵活部署:快速创建、删除和复制虚拟机,便于快速部署和调整资源
3.成本节约:通过整合物理服务器,减少硬件投资,降低运维成本
4.兼容性增强:轻松实现不同操作系统、应用程序的共存与测试
二、影响虚拟机Windows流畅度的关键因素 尽管虚拟机技术带来了诸多便利,但其性能表现,尤其是Windows系统的流畅度,受到多种因素的影响: 1.物理硬件性能:CPU、内存、磁盘IO等物理资源的性能直接影响虚拟机的运行效率
高性能的硬件基础是保障虚拟机流畅运行的前提
2.虚拟化软件的选择与配置:不同的虚拟化软件(如VMware Workstation、VirtualBox、Hyper-V等)在性能优化、资源管理上有各自的特点
合理配置虚拟化软件参数,如分配给虚拟机的CPU核心数、内存大小等,对流畅度至关重要
3.操作系统与应用程序的优化:Windows系统的版本、补丁情况、运行的应用程序及其资源占用情况,也会影响虚拟机的流畅性
定期更新系统、优化应用配置,能有效提升性能
4.网络性能:虚拟机与外界的网络通信速度,特别是当涉及到大文件传输、远程访问时,对用户体验有显著影响
选择高性能的网络适配器、优化网络设置,可以提升网络性能
5.存储介质:虚拟机的磁盘文件存放位置及其读写速度,直接影响启动速度和运行效率
使用SSD替代HDD,或将虚拟机文件存放在高速存储设备上,能显著提升性能
三、实际测试体验:虚拟机Windows流畅度验证 为了更直观地展示虚拟机Windows系统的流畅度,我们进行了以下测试: - 测试环境:采用一台配置较高的台式机,CPU为Intel i7-10700K,内存32GB DDR4,系统盘为1TB NVMe SSD,运行VMware Workstation 16 Pro作为虚拟化软件
- 虚拟机配置:创建两个Windows 10虚拟机,分别分配4核CPU、8GB内存和100GB SSD存储空间,网络适配器设置为桥接模式
测试内容: 1. 系统启动时间:从开机到登录桌面的时间
2. 日常操作响应:包括打开常用软件(如Office、浏览器)、文件复制、多任务切换等
3. 图形处理能力:运行轻度图形应用(如Photoshop)、视频播放(1080P)、简单游戏(如《扫雷》、《纸牌》)
4. 网络性能:下载/上传速度测试,使用Speedtest进行
5. 压力测试:同时运行多个资源密集型应用(如虚拟机内运行大型软件、视频编码),观察系统稳定性
测试结果: -系统启动时间:两个虚拟机均在20秒左右完成启动,接近原生Windows系统的启动速度
-日常操作响应:操作流畅,无明显卡顿现象,多任务切换迅速
-图形处理能力:轻度图形应用运行流畅,视频播放无缓冲,简单游戏无延迟
-网络性能:网络速度接近物理机,下载/上传速度差异不超过10%
-压力测试:在高负载情况下,虚拟机虽略有延迟,但整体保持稳定,未出现崩溃现象
四、优化建议与注意事项 为了确保虚拟机Windows系统的最佳流畅度,以下是一些优化建议: 1.合理分配资源:根据实际需求,为虚拟机分配足够的CPU核心数和内存,避免资源竞争
2.启用虚拟化技术:确保BIOS中启用了Intel VT-x或AMD-V等虚拟化技术,以提升虚拟化性能
3.使用SSD存储:将虚拟机文件存放在SSD上,显著提升读写速度
4.网络优化:选择高性能网络适配器,并根据需要调整网络设置,如使用桥接模式提高网络性能
5.定期更新与维护:保持虚拟化软件、Windows系统及应用程序的更新,定期清理垃圾文件,优化系统配置
6.关闭不必要的服务:在虚拟机内关闭不必要的后台服务和启动项,减少资源占用
五、结论 综上所述,虚拟机的Windows系统能否流畅运行,取决于多方面的因素
在硬件性能达标、虚拟化软件合理配置、系统及应用优化得当的前提下,虚拟机中的Windows系统完全能够提供接近原生体验的流畅度
通过实际测试,我们验证了这一点,证明了虚拟机技术在保证性能的同时,也能满足多样化的应用场景需求
因此,对于需要在虚拟机中运行Windows系统的用户而言,只要合理规划与管理,完全可以享受到高效、流畅的使用体验
VB安装Win7虚拟机教程指南
虚拟机Windows运行是否流畅?
智能云台电脑安装全攻略
云承软件电脑安装教程与步骤
一键搭建云电脑,轻松上手教程
Win10系统下轻松安装XP虚拟机:详细步骤与教程
虚拟机安装Win7深度64位系统教程
VB安装Win7虚拟机教程指南
Win10系统下轻松安装XP虚拟机:详细步骤与教程
虚拟机安装Win7深度64位系统教程
UTM装Win7无网解决方案
Win10虚拟机必备软件推荐
威锋论坛热议:虚拟机安装Win10教程全攻略
Win10虚拟机:内存配置需求详解
ARM架构运行Windows虚拟机
Win8能否在虚拟机上运行?
光速虚拟机无法打开MT管理器怎么办
高效卸载秘籍:虚拟机Win7卸载工具全解析与使用指南
Win8.1下安装XP虚拟机教程